We recently noticed an issue in PI that if we were creating\updating some design objects in IR and ID the same were working on older version or doesn't even reflected at runtime if it is newly created.
Case is that we created a channel in ID but when we were checking it in 'Communication Channel Monitoring' it was not visible under the all channels list and the mappings we were updating that were not even executing as per the current version.
It clearly seems to be a cache issue which we can fix in IR and ID itself. PFB the steps that will help us in resolving these kind of cache issues.
Step 1:
Go to Environment Tab and look for Cache Notifications… You will see recent entries with relevant details. If the entries are in green then it’s OK but if not then that is the problem to us.
Step 2:
When you select one entry or more then the Icons on the left side get enabled for you and you can execute them as per requirement. The highlighted one is for Cache Update.
Step 3:
Below one is one example where you can see the entry is in Red status that means it is in error and you need to update that or delete that.
Step 4:
Select the erroneous entry and Click on ‘Repeat Cache Notification’ Icon, which will change the status from red to green. And after that you are done.
Cache issues should get resolve by following these steps